On 2026-03-10 18:12:18 [-0700], Eric Biggers wrote:
> > diff --git a/scripts/modules-merkle-tree.c b/scripts/modules-merkle-tree.c
> [...]
> 
> > +struct file_entry {
> > +	char *name;
> > +	unsigned int pos;
> > +	unsigned char hash[EVP_MAX_MD_SIZE];
> 
> Considering that the hash algorithm is fixed, EVP_MAX_MD_SIZE can be
> replaced with a tighter local definition:
> 
>     #define MAX_HASH_SIZE 32
> 
> > +static struct file_entry *fh_list;
> > +static size_t num_files;
> > +
> > +struct leaf_hash {
> > +	unsigned char hash[EVP_MAX_MD_SIZE];
> > +};
> > +
> > +struct mtree {
> > +	struct leaf_hash **l;
> > +	unsigned int *entries;
> > +	unsigned int levels;
> > +};
> 
> 'struct leaf_hash' is confusing because it's actually used for the
> hashes of internal nodes, not leaf nodes.

You could still consider the internal nodes as leafs.

> Maybe rename it to 'struct hash' and use it for both the hashes and leaf
> nodes and internal nodes.
> 
> Also, clearer naming would improve readability, e.g.:
> 
>     struct merkle_tree {
>             struct hash **level_hashes;
>             unsigned int level_size;
>             unsigned int num_levels;
>     };

but this could improve it, indeed.

> > +	hash_evp = EVP_get_digestbyname("sha256");
> 
> EVP_sha256()

I would suggest to use EVP_MD_fetch() instead.

> > +	hash_size = EVP_MD_get_size(hash_evp);
> 
> The old name 'EVP_MD_size()' would have wider compatibility.

EVP_MD_fetch() and EVP_MD_get_size() are openssl 3.0.0+ and nothing
below 3.0.0 is considered supported (while 3.0.0 is EOL 07 Sep 2026).
